Kunshan Xuan Yida machinery introduction: PVC material molding conditions are what? How is it processed?


PVC material is now more and more seen in life, modern life is obviously inseparable from his existence, so PVC material used in our raw materials of so many products, what is his molding condition? What is the processing method? Let's take a look.

A, PVC material forming conditions

1, hard PVC

Feed tube temperature: 160-190℃

Mold temperature: 40-60℃

Drying temperature: 80℃×2h

Injection pressure: 700-1500kg/cm2

Density: 1.4 g/cm3

Forming shrinkage: 0.1-0.5%

Thick meat: 2.0-50 mm

Water absorption (24h) : 0.1-0.4%

Melting degree softening point: 89℃

Thermal deformation temperature: 70℃


2, soft PVC

Feed tube temperature: 140-170℃

Mold temperature: 40-60℃

Drying temperature: 80℃×2h

Injection pressure: 600-1500 kg/cm2

Density: 1.4g /cm3

Forming shrinkage: 0.1-0.5%

Thick meat: 2.0-50 mm

Water absorption (24h) : 0.1-0.4%

Melting degree softening point: 85℃

Thermal deformation temperature: 55℃


Two, PVC material processing

1, PVC plastic forms are different, very different, processing methods are also diverse, can be pressed, extrusion, injection, coating, etc. Polyvinyl chloride resin particle size, fisheye, loose density, purity, foreign impurities, porosity have an impact on processing; The viscosity and gelatinizing properties of the paste should be considered.

2. Polyvinyl chloride is an amorphous polymer with small shrinkage. Powder should be preheated before processing to remove water, enhance the plasticizing effect, prevent bubbles. And PVC is easy to decompose, especially in high temperature and steel, copper contact easier decomposition (decomposition temperature 200 degrees). Forming temperature range is small, must strictly control the material temperature. When using screw injection machine and through nozzle, the aperture should be large to prevent the dead Angle stagnation. The mold pouring system should be thick, the gate section should be large, the mold should be cooled, the mold temperature is 30-60℃, the material temperature is 160-190℃.

3. Under the glass transition temperature (Tg, 80℃), polyvinyl chloride is glassy; In the Tg→ viscous flow temperature (Tf, about 160℃) is a high elastic rubber, plasticity; At Tf→ thermal decomposition temperature (Td), the flow is viscous. The higher the temperature, the easier the flow is. When the temperature exceeds Td, PVC dissolves a large amount of hydrogen chloride (HCl), and the material loses its chemical stability and physical properties, so Td is the upper limit temperature for processing and molding. Due to the high intermolecular force of polyethylene, Tf is very high, even close to the decomposition temperature, so it is necessary to add plasticizer to reduce Tf. On the other hand, it is also necessary to add stabilizer, so as to improve the Td of PVC, in order to be processed.

4. The glass transition temperature (Tg) is only related to the structure of the molecular chain segment, and has little relationship with the molecular weight, while the viscosity flow temperature (Tf) is the temperature at which the macromolecule starts to move, and is related to the molecular weight. The larger the molecular weight, the higher the Tf. For some processes, such as injection molding, it is necessary to reduce the molecular weight of the resin. According to the size of the different molecular weight, domestic suspended polyvinyl chloride resin is divided into 1-7 levels, the larger the serial number, the smaller the molecular weight. XJ-4 (XS-4) to XJ-7 (XS-7) resins are often used in the manufacture of hard tubes and hard plates, etc. Other resins with lower molecular weight need to add a large amount of plasticizer to reduce Tf due to high Tf, so they are often used in the manufacture of soft products. PVC with average polymerization degree below 1000 is called low polymerization degree PVC, which has better processing performance. In the processing process, less plasticizer can be added, so as not to accelerate the aging of products due to the migration of plasticizer. Polyvinyl chloride products with low degree of polymerization have good transparency, widely used in building materials, food and drug packaging materials and instead of plexiglass products.


5. Polyvinyl chloride melt is a non-Newtonian pseudo-fluid. The larger the shear velocity, the smaller the apparent viscosity, and the change is quite sensitive. Increase the temperature, viscosity is not reduced much, even if the plastic is below the decomposition temperature, but because of a long time in a higher temperature, it will also heat and oxidation degradation phenomenon, and affect its performance. Therefore, increasing shear rate (increasing pressure) should be considered to improve the fluidity of PVC melt. In fact, increasing the external force helps the movement of macromolecules, so that the Tf is reduced and the macromolecules can flow at a lower temperature.
